Cary London is a personal injury attorney with 16 years of legal experience, practicing at Shulman & Hill, PLLC in New York, NY. He earned a degree from University of Virginia Bachelor in 2006 and a degree from New York Law School Jurist Doctorate in 2009. He has been admitted to the New York Bar since 2010. His practice encompasses personal injury, civil rights, and criminal defense,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. In addition to English, he is proficient in Spanish. Mr. London offers contingency fee arrangements, making legal representation more accessible to those in need.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
